The ingredients needed to make Crockpot Chicken Bacon Ranch sliders:
  1. Make ready 3-4 chicken breast
  2. Prepare 1 packet ranch dressing mix (dry)
  3. Prepare 1 (8 oz) cream cheese
  4. Take Cooked and crumble bacon or turkey bacon
  5. Make ready Other cheese,lettuce tomatoes, are optional
  6. Take Hawaiian rolls

Instructions to make Crockpot Chicken Bacon Ranch sliders:
  1. Cook bacon or turkey bacon, cut and crumble set aside.
  2. Add all other ingredients to crockpot. Cook on high 4hrs low 6/8 hrs cook till chicken is done (can use frozen chicken) cooking times will vary depending on the crockpot each one is different always temp the meat.
  3. Shred chicken and mix well. Then add the bacon and some cheese if you like and mix. Then it’s done. (leave in the juice from the chicken don’t drain it) if this gets to thick add some chicken stock to it.
  4. Notes- this can be made in an instant pot just add 1 or 2 cups of chicken stock, keep in mind it will come out more liquidity (I would try only using one cup of liquid)
  5. This is the first time I tried this and it works. Shred chicken with a handheld mixer. Some of it did come out of the crockpot,but not to much.
  6. I had a family pack of 18 Hawaiian rolls. Ended up with none left and had some meat mixture left over for lunch the next day.
